Senior Data Scientist (Loyalty Analytics)

What you'll do

  • Develop analytical and machine-learning solutions to improve member acquisition, engagement, retention, and lifetime value.
  • Build segmentation, propensity, recommendation, uplift, and optimization models for loyalty use cases.
  • Design and analyze experiments, including test-and-control frameworks and causal-impact measurement.
  • Translate business questions into rigorous analytical approaches and actionable recommendations.
  • Partner with product managers, engineers, analysts, marketers, and other data scientists to define priorities and deliver production-ready solutions.
  • Establish success metrics and measurement frameworks for loyalty initiatives.
  • Communicate findings clearly to technical and non-technical audiences, including senior stakeholders.
  • Promote high standards for data quality, reproducibility, model governance, and responsible use of customer data.
  • Contribute to the evolution of the organisation's loyalty data platform and data products.

What you'll bring

  • Significant experience in data science, advanced analytics, or a closely related quantitative field.
  • Strong programming skills in Python and SQL.
  • Practical experience with statistical modelling, machine learning, experimentation, and causal inference.
  • Experience working with customer, marketing, CRM, membership, rewards, or personalization data.
  • Ability to work with large-scale, complex, and evolving data environments.
  • Strong product sense and the ability to connect analytical outputs to customer and commercial outcomes.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• A collaborative, pragmatic approach and a track record of delivering outcomes through cross-functional partnerships.

Requirements

Preferred qualifications

  • Experience with loyalty, travel, marketplaces, subscriptions, rewards, or customer lifecycle analytics.
  • 8+ years of experience in a similar analytical role.
  • Experience developing models that influence customer journeys or marketing decisions.
  • Experience taking models from prototyping through deployment, monitoring, and iteration.
  • Graduate degree in statistics, computer science, operations research, economics, mathematics, or a related quantitative discipline.
